What are Side-Opening Door Incinerators?

Side-opening door incinerators are a type of incinerator designed with an opening door that allows for easy access and removal of ashes and debris. Unlike traditional incinerators, which often require a ladder or special equipment to clean, side-opening door incinerators provide a safe and convenient way to dispose of waste without having to lift a finger.

Real-Life Applications

From hospitals and healthcare facilities to restaurants and retail establishments, side-opening door incinerators are used in a variety of commercial settings to improve efficiency and hygiene. Here are a few examples:

  • Restaurants: Restaurants often struggle with odors and messes from food waste. Side-opening door incinerators provide a convenient and hygienic way to dispose of food waste without disturbing the rest of the kitchen.
  • Healthcare Facilities: Healthcare facilities, such as hospitals and clinics, generate a significant amount of medical waste, including biohazardous materials. Side-opening door incinerators provide a safe and secure way to dispose of these materials.
  • Retail Establishments: Retail establishments, such as grocery stores and malls, often have a high volume of waste, including packaging and product returns. Side-opening door incinerators can help reduce odors and messes while making it easy to dispose of waste.
